> The information is in the NED, which you can display with DS QD,devn,RCD.
>
>
>
> Unfortunately, the model information the emulated IBM device, but the
> vendor ID and serial number should get you halfway there.
>
>
>
>
> +4 (4)
>
>
>
> 6 Bytes
>
> Device Type, in EBCDIC.
>
>
> +10 (A)
>
>
>
> 3 Bytes
>
> Device Model, in EBCDIC.
>
>
> +13 (D)
>
>
>
> 3 Bytes
>
> Manufacturer, in EBCDIC.
>
>
> +16 (10)
>
>
>
> 2 Bytes
>
> Manufacturing location, in EBCDIC.
>
>
> +18 (12)
>
>
>
> 12 Bytes
>
> Serial number, in EBCDIC. This field is right justified, padded with
> leading zeros in EBCDIC.
>
>
> So “C8E3C3 F7F5” is “HTC 75.”

> The information is also available on in the Type 74 subtype 1 and 5
> records, and the RMFPP Cache Summary report.
